Custom Configuration. We offer custom configuration services such as the installation of accessories and
expansion products, loading of software, imaging for custom applications and configuration of network
operating systems. These services are performed in a configuration center within our distribution center. Our
custom configuration services benefit our customers by reducing the cost and time necessary to deploy new
products into their existing technology environment.
Technical Support. Our technical staff is well-trained and maintains high levels of professional
certification from product manufacturers. We employ a technical staff of more than 160 with over 440
manufacturer certifications to assist our customers with technical questions and issues during regular business
hours. We offer technical support services by telephone 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. We believe that our
commitment to service at the time of sale and after the purchase maximizes sales opportunities and encourages
repeat customers.
Information Technology. We use proprietary, real-time information technology systems which centralize
the management of key functions and generate daily operating reports enabling management to identify and
respond quickly to internal changes and to provide high levels of customer satisfaction. We also monitor trends
in the technology industry. We integrate our real-time systems with our Web sites, CDW.com, CDWG.com,
macwarehouse.com and CDW.ca, providing real-time information for our customers.
Effective Inventory Control. Our inventory tracking system, purchasing system, cycle counting system and
use of vendor stock balancing and price protection programs allow us to minimize our investment in inventory
and to reduce inventory discrepancies and the risk of obsolescence while meeting customer needs by shipping
orders generally on a same-day basis.
High Quality Coworkers. We strive to attract, retain and motivate high quality coworkers and provide our
coworkers with competitive compensation and incentives designed to maximize performance and productivity.
Our objective is, whenever possible, to promote coworkers from within the Company to positions of increased
responsibility. Examples of rewards and motivations for our coworkers include short-term incentive programs,
stock-based compensation and an on-site childcare and fitness center facility at our Vernon Hills, Illinois
headquarters.
Product Offering
We sell multi-brand computers and related technology products, including hardware and peripherals,
software, accessories and other products, for use on a variety of technology operating platforms, including
Microsoft, Apple, Linux, Novel, Unix and others.
We continually seek to expand and improve our relationships with manufacturers as well as increase the
number of products which we are authorized to sell.
Purchasing and Vendor Relationships
We purchase products for resale from manufacturers, distributors and other sources, all of whom we
consider our vendors. During 2004, we purchased approximately 50% of the products we sold directly from
manufacturers and the remaining amount from distributors and other sources. We believe that effective
purchasing from a diverse vendor base is a key element of our business strategy. For the year ended December
31, 2004, purchases from distributors Ingram Micro and Tech Data represented approximately 19% and 16%,
respectively, of our total purchases. Additionally, in 2004, sales of products manufactured by Hewlett-Packard
comprised approximately 28% of our total sales.
Our marketing and purchasing staffs work together to identify reliable, high-quality suppliers of products,
then actively negotiate to achieve the lowest possible cost and expand vendor incentive programs. We seek to
establish strong relationships with our vendors, and employ a policy of paying vendors within stated terms and
taking advantage of all appropriate discounts. Several of our leading vendors, such as Hewlett-Packard, IBM
and Microsoft, have full-time product specialists on-site at our facilities.
